如何进行Oracle PLM系统的数据迁移?

在进行Oracle PLM系统的数据迁移时,需要考虑到数据量、数据类型、迁移工具以及迁移过程中的风险控制等多个方面。以下是一篇关于如何进行Oracle PLM系统数据迁移的文章,旨在为读者提供详细的迁移指南。

一、了解Oracle PLM系统

Oracle PLM(Product Lifecycle Management)系统是一种产品生命周期管理软件,旨在帮助企业实现产品从研发、设计、生产到售后服务的全生命周期管理。在迁移之前,首先要对Oracle PLM系统的功能、架构和业务流程有深入的了解。

二、确定数据迁移范围

在迁移之前,需要明确以下内容:

  1. 确定需要迁移的数据类型,如产品信息、文档、BOM(物料清单)、BOM结构、变更记录等。

  2. 分析数据迁移的优先级,如哪些数据对业务影响较大,应优先迁移。

  3. 了解现有数据库架构,如表结构、字段类型、索引等。

三、选择合适的迁移工具

目前,市场上存在多种Oracle PLM系统数据迁移工具,如Ora2Ora、Toad Data Modeler、Oracle SQL Developer等。在选择迁移工具时,应考虑以下因素:

  1. 工具的成熟度和稳定性,确保数据迁移过程顺利进行。

  2. 工具的功能,如支持多种数据类型、批量迁移、增量迁移等。

  3. 工具的易用性,降低迁移过程中的学习成本。

  4. 工具的技术支持,确保在迁移过程中遇到问题时能够及时解决。

四、数据迁移步骤

  1. 数据备份:在迁移之前,对现有Oracle PLM系统进行数据备份,以防迁移过程中出现意外导致数据丢失。

  2. 数据清理:对迁移数据进行清理,如删除无效、重复或异常的数据,确保数据质量。

  3. 数据映射:根据目标Oracle PLM系统的数据结构,将源系统中的数据字段映射到目标系统中的相应字段。

  4. 数据迁移:使用选定的迁移工具,将数据从源系统迁移到目标系统。

  5. 数据验证:在迁移完成后,对迁移后的数据进行验证,确保数据准确无误。

  6. 数据同步:如果源系统和目标系统存在数据同步需求,设置数据同步策略,实现数据实时更新。

五、风险控制

  1. 数据安全:在迁移过程中,确保数据安全,防止数据泄露或被恶意篡改。

  2. 迁移中断:在迁移过程中,如遇到意外情况导致迁移中断,确保能够及时恢复到中断前的状态。

  3. 业务连续性:在迁移过程中,确保业务连续性,减少对生产业务的影响。

  4. 迁移成本:在迁移过程中,合理控制迁移成本,避免不必要的开支。

六、总结

进行Oracle PLM系统的数据迁移是一项复杂的任务,需要充分准备和精心操作。通过以上步骤,可以确保数据迁移过程顺利进行,实现业务平滑过渡。在实际操作过程中,还需根据具体情况进行调整和优化。

猜你喜欢:CAD制图